Premium Hotels in Nairobi
Karen
Kenyatta Hospital
Spring Valley
Embakasi
Kenyatta Hospital
Thindigua
You are booking hotel for more than 90 days
Embakasi, Nairobi
Karen
Kenyatta Hospital
Spring Valley
Embakasi
Kenyatta Hospital
Thindigua
Maziwa
Karen
Highridge
Kitisuru
Highway Estate
Embakasi
Highridge
Karen
Kitisuru
Kenyatta Hospital
Muthangari
Muthangari
Maziwa
Marurui
Kitisuru
Muthangari
Spring Valley
Kitisuru
Highridge
Karen